We implement and evaluate the different methods using blockchain in this paper. This paper presents the systematic study of modern blockchain-based solutions for securing medical data with or without cloud computing. Utilizing the blockchain which secure healthcare records management has been of recent interest. The blockchain made focused on bitcoin technology among the researchers. Blockchain-based security solutions gained significant attention in the recent past due to the ability to provide strong security for data storage and sharing with the minimum computation efforts. However, such conventional solutions failed to achieve the trade-off between the requirements of EHR security solutions such as computational efficiency, service side verification, user side verifications, without the trusted third party, and strong security. To achieve secure medical data storage, sharing, and accessing in cloud service provider, several cryptography algorithms are designed so far. Therefore storing, accessing, and sharing the patient medical information on the cloud needs security attention that data should not be compromised by the authorized user's components of E-healthcare systems. The sensitive and personal data of patients lead to several challenges while protecting it from hackers. Healthcare 4.0 mainly consisted of periodic medical data sensing, aggregation, data transmission, data sharing, and data storage. The recent development of Healthcare 4.0 using the Internet of Things (IoT) components and cloud computing to access medical operations remotely has gained the researcher's attention from a smart city perspective. Since the last decade, cloud-based electronic health records (EHRs) have gained significant attention to enable remote patient monitoring.
